SOUTH KOREA'S CRYPTO GIANT BITHUMB ROLLS OUT COMPENSATION AFTER $44 BILLION BITCOIN ERROR SPARKS REGULATORY FIRESTORM

In a dramatic response to one of the most costly technical errors in financial history, South Korean cryptocurrency exchange Bithumb has initiated a sweeping compensation plan for its users. This move comes just days after an internal mistake led to the accidental distribution of bitcoin worth an estimated $44 billion to hundreds of users, triggering a market panic and immediate government intervention.

The exchange, one of Asia's largest, confirmed it began rolling out the phased compensation on February 9, marking the first major step toward resolution after a week of chaos that has shaken confidence in the nation's digital asset industry.

The Aftermath and Bithumb's Recovery Plan

Following the January 30 incident, where 695 users were mistakenly credited with approximately 620,000 bitcoins instead of small cash rewards, Bithumb's engineering teams worked around the clock to contain the fallout. The company successfully recovered 99.7% of the erroneously distributed assets within 35 minutes by freezing affected accounts. However, the remaining 0.3%—worth roughly $9 million—was sold by users before the freeze, causing a precipitous 17% flash crash on Bithumb's platform.

Facing immense public pressure and regulatory scrutiny, Bithumb unveiled a multi-tiered compensation strategy that officially went into effect today:

•· A flat payment of 20,000 Korean won (approximately $13.66) to all users logged in during the incident period.

•· Full reimbursement, plus an additional 10% bonus, for users who sold assets at a loss during the brief market crash induced by the error.

•· A seven-day waiver of all trading fees across every listed cryptocurrency.

The incident was caused by an internal processing error and was not a security breach or hack,
a Bithumb spokesperson reiterated in a public statement.
We have taken full responsibility and are deploying system safeguards, including mandatory dual-approval protocols for all future payouts, to ensure this cannot be repeated.

Regulators Launch Emergency Investigation

The sheer scale of the error has provoked a forceful response from South Korean authorities. The nation's top financial watchdog, the Financial Services Commission (FSC), has formed an emergency task force to conduct a thorough on-site inspection of Bithumb's systems and operational controls. This probe is expected to set a precedent for heightened oversight across the sector.

In a press briefing, an FSC official starkly criticized the lapse, stating the event

exposed the critical vulnerabilities in the internal control systems of virtual asset service providers
and highlighted systemic risks to consumers. The official confirmed that the findings from Bithumb would inform a broader review of controls at other domestic exchanges.

The incident has also accelerated legislative action in the National Assembly. Lawmakers are now fast-tracking discussions on the long-pending Digital Asset Basic Act, with new amendments likely to mandate real-time transaction monitoring systems and stricter capital reserve requirements for exchanges. The error has become a focal point in debates over consumer protection, with one legislator calling it a "wake-up call for the entire digital finance ecosystem."

Technical Flaw and Industry-Wide Reckoning

Analysts note that the mistake was possible because the massive payout occurred on Bithumb's internal, off-chain ledger—a record-keeping system for user balances that operates separately from the public Bitcoin blockchain. This allowed the exchange to reverse the credits quickly but also revealed a single point of catastrophic failure.

The fact that a keystroke error could result in a $44 billion liability shows how fragile the plumbing of some crypto exchanges still is,
commented a Seoul-based fintech analyst.

The Bithumb blunder has sent shockwaves through the global cryptocurrency industry, occurring ironically just as South Korea moves to embrace digital assets more fully. The government recently lifted a nine-year ban on corporate cryptocurrency investment, and regulators are crafting rules for stablecoin issuance. This incident now threatens to temper that progress with much stricter operational mandates.

For the millions of cryptocurrency traders in South Korea, a nation with one of the world's highest rates of crypto adoption, the event is a stark reminder of the risks that persist on the platforms they trust with their assets. While Bithumb's compensation addresses immediate financial losses, the deeper loss of trust may take far longer to repair.

As the FSC's investigation continues, the industry awaits a regulatory crackdown that could redefine how exchanges operate. The events of the past week underscore a pivotal moment: as digital assets move further into the mainstream, the tolerance for errors of any magnitude is rapidly diminishing. The path Bithumb and its regulators take now will likely chart the course for the future of cryptocurrency trading in South Korea and beyond.
